i am one of those who bought a lot of magazine (English and Chinese even Japanese watch mag too) but in my opinion, like other too, the mag sometimes are too bias and they will "give face" to the brand and tell most of the good stuff only...

except one that i'm happy to read is the Spiral Watch Mag, it's a HK mag and hard to get in Msia.. usually i have my friend to buy it for me from HK coz she travel HK very frequent... i like about this Mag because it do a lot of comparison on watches head to head and a lot of test on the watches too, not so bias as compare to those Taiwan/US/UK based mag ;)

If you can read Jap, i will encourage you to get Jap's watch mag too... the Jap one are so professional and they very detail describe the watches..for example, they will compare the 116610 and 16610 in detail with a lot photo too... that's why even i can't read jap i still enjoy "reading" it :D Also, the jap mag sometimes do report on the used pieces market too...
